Equestrian Community Comes Together to Help Claire Davis

Seventeen year old Claire Davis was the unfortunate victim of a school shooting at Arapahoe High School on December 13. Claire remains in critical condition after sustaining a gunshot wound to the head. Meanwhile, news broke that Claire is a fellow equestrian, and immediately the equine community banded together to help her.

The Colorado Horse Park, CANTER Colorado and other members of the Colorado equestrian family have started raising funds for Claire’s Care. It is truly heartwarming to know that even in the times of the hardest struggles, the equine community remains small and dedicated to helping those in their time of need.
